Origin and Meaning of the Name Olava


Origin

The name Olava is of Scandinavian origin. It is a variant of the name Olaf, which comes from Old Norse elements "anu" meaning "ancestor" and "leifr" meaning "heir" or "descendant".

Meaning

The name Olava carries the beautiful meaning of "ancestor's descendant" or "heir of ancestors". It symbolizes a connection to one's roots and heritage, reflecting a sense of continuity and tradition.

In Scandinavian culture, names like Olava often hold significance in honoring family lineage and the continuation of familial legacies. The name exudes a sense of pride in one's ancestry and the values passed down through generations.
